description Product Description

Used primarily in the pharmaceutical industry as an intermediate in the synthesis of various drugs, particularly sulfonamide-based antibiotics. It plays a key role in developing compounds with antibacterial properties, targeting a wide range of bacterial infections. Additionally, it is utilized in research and development for creating new therapeutic agents, especially in the field of ant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ory medications. Its sulfonamide group is essential for binding to bacterial enzymes, inhibiting their function and preventing bacterial growth.
